The Position

  • Reports to the Chair, Department of Surgery (clinically), Jefferson Medical Group Administrative team.

Assists the Department Chair in the performance of his/her duties, including:

  • Responsible for and accountable to all professional and administrative activities within the Division;
  • Ensures the implementation of a systematic process for monitoring and evaluating the quality and appropriateness of patient care and treatment provided by the Division, as well as the clinical performance of all individuals with clinical privileges;
  • Maintains ongoing surveillance of the professional and clinical performance of all individuals with privileges in the Division;
  • Develops criteria, including Practitioner Specific Quality Profiles, for evaluating members' ability to perform privileges requested and current competence (OPPE/FPPE);
  • Recommends criteria for clinical privileges to the Medical Staff;
  • Recommends clinical privileges for each Department member;
  • Defines and monitors the fulfillment of other academic and administrative duties as required by academic relationships with medical, dental, or podiatric schools;
  • Coordinates and integrates interdepartmental and intra-departmental services;
  • Develops and implements policies and procedures to guide and support care, treatment, and services;
  • Recommends space and other resources needed by the Department or service;
  • Advises administrative leadership on equipment, new programs, and services necessary to grow patient volumes;
  • Manages the vascular surgery clinician team to ensure appropriate inpatient and outpatient coverage;
  • Attends Medical Staff Meetings;
  • Monitors office patient volumes to ensure appropriate clinical wait times for both office and surgical care.

About Jefferson

Nationally ranked, Jefferson, primarily located in the greater Philadelphia region, Lehigh Valley, Northeastern Pennsylvania, and southern New Jersey, is reimagining healthcare and higher education to create unparalleled value. Jefferson employs over 65,000 people dedicated to providing high-quality, compassionate clinical care, making communities healthier and stronger, preparing future professionals, and advancing research. Thomas Jefferson University, home of Sidney Kimmel Medical College, Jefferson College of Nursing, and the Kanbar College of Design, Engineering, and Commerce, dates back to 1824 and offers over 200 undergraduate and graduate programs to more than 8,300 students across 10 colleges and three schools.

Jefferson Health is a nationally ranked, top 15 not-for-profit healthcare system, serving patients through 32 hospital campuses and over 700 outpatient and urgent care locations in Pennsylvania and New Jersey. Jefferson Health Plans has provided a broad range of health coverage options for over 35 years.
